WebFeb 13, 2024 · Period and Frequency of Sinusoidal Functions. The general equation for a sinusoidal function is: f (x)=±a⋅sin (b (x+c))+d. The ± controls the reflection across the x -axis. The coefficient a controls the amplitude. The constant d controls the vertical shift. Here you will see that the coefficient b controls the horizontal stretch. WebFeb 15, 2016 · Explanation: Period of sin t --> 2π. Period of sin( t 2) --> 4π. Period of sin( 2t 5) --> 10π 2 = 5π. Least multiple of 4pi and 5pi --> 20 pi. Common period of f (t) --> 20π.
